Gatwick Express and Train Services
Rail connections from Gatwick Airport have long been favored by commuters and budget-conscious travelers seeking quick access to London’s city center. With multiple service providers operating regular routes throughout the day, trains offer a predictable and traffic-free alternative to road transport. Understanding the cost variations and journey specifics between different rail services can help you maximize value while minimizing travel time.

Pricing Structure
The Gatwick Express remains one of the most popular options for solo travelers and those heading directly to central London. A standard single ticket costs approximately £20-£25 when booked in advance, though prices can climb to £30 or more when purchased on the day of travel. Thameslink and Southern Railway services offer cheaper alternatives, with fares starting around £10-£15 for similar routes.
Journey Time
The Gatwick Express boasts a non-stop service to Victoria Station, completing the journey in approximately 30 minutes. However, this doesn’t account for:
- Walking time from the gate to the platform (10-15 minutes)
- Waiting time for the next departure (up to 15 minutes)
- Additional travel from Victoria to your final destination
- Potential delays during peak hours

Pricing Dynamics
Uber pricing from Gatwick to central London typically ranges between £45-£75 for standard services, though this can fluctuate dramatically based on demand. During peak hours, early mornings, or special events, surge pricing can push costs well above £100. Unlike fixed-rate taxi services, you won’t know the exact price until you request the ride.
Time Considerations
Journey times via Uber usually take 60-90 minutes to reach central London, heavily dependent on traffic conditions. The M23 and A23 routes can experience significant congestion during rush hours, potentially extending your journey by 30-45 minutes or more.
